Applications
3′,4′,5,7-Tetrahydroxyflavone is used as an apoptosis inducer.

Solubility
Soluble in aqueous alkaline solutions (1.4 mg/ml), ethanol (∼5 mg/ml), dimethyl sulfoxide (7 mg/ml), 1eq. Sodium hydroxide (5 mM), dimethylformamide (∼20 mg/ml), water (1 mg/ml) at 25°C and methanol.

Notes
Incompatible with strong oxidizing agents. Store in cool place. Keep container tightly closed in a dry and well-ventilated place. Recommended storage temperature is 2 - 8°C.
